Definitions
- the field of the invention relates to a process for the preparation of N 2 -Acetyl-9- (l,3-diacetoxy-2-propoxymethyl) guanme, referred to here as N-9 alkylated isomer of structural Formula I, and to the use of this compound as an intermediate for the preparation of antiviral compound, ganciclovir.
- ganciclovir is 9-(l,3-dihydroxy-2-propoxymethyl)guanine of structural Formula II,
- N-9 substituted guanine compounds involves the direct alkylation of appropriately substituted 2-aminopurines, for example guanine derivatives which on deprotection of the functional group are converted to final products .
- DAG diacetyl guanine
- MAG monoacetyl guanine
- N-7 N 2 -Acetyl-7-(l,3-diacetoxy-2-propoxymethyl) guanine, referred to as N-7 isomer of structural Formula V, and
- the present invention provides a process which does not require the purification of the penultimate intermediate or the final product by HPLC or other techniques, rather uses organic solvents and / or water or mixtures thereof. The choice of which has been found to be important for removing the traces of polar and non- polar impurities.
- N 2 -acetyl-9- (l,3-diacetoxy-2-propoxymethyl) guanme the N-9 alkylated isomer in pure form.
- the process includes obtaining a solution of N 2 -acetyl-9-(l,3-diacetoxy-2-propoxymethyl) guanme in one or more solvents; and recovering the pure N 2 -acetyl-9-(l,3-diacetoxy-2- propoxymethyl) guanine by the removal of the solvent.
- the solvent may be one or more of lower alkanol, ketone, chlorinated solvent, water, or mixtures thereof.
- the lower alkanol may include one or more of primary, secondary and tertiary alcohol having from one to six carbon atoms.
- the lower alkanol may include one or more of methanol, ethanol, denatured spirit, n-propanol, isopropanol, n-butanol, isobutanol and t-butanol.
- the lower alkanol may include one or more of methanol, ethanol, and denatured spirit.
- the ketone may include one or more of acetone, 2-butanone, and 4-methylpentan- 2-one.
- the chlorinated solvent may include one or more of dichloromethane, dichloroethane and chloroform. Removing the solvent may include one or more of distillation, distillation under vacuum, filtration, filtration under vacuum, decantation and centrifugation.
- the process may include further drying of the product obtained.
- the solution containing N -acetyl-9-(l,3-diacetoxy-2- propoxymethyl) guanine may be cooled and filtered to remove unreacted solids before the removal of the solvent.
- additional solvent may be added to residue obtained after removal of the solvent and it may be cooled before filtration to obtain better yields of the N-9 isomer.
- the pure N-9 isomer has a purity of more than 98% having less than about 0.5% of monoacetyl and diacetyl impurity and less than about 0.5% of N-7 alkylated isomer impurity. More particularly, the purity of the N-9 isomer is more than 98.5% having less than about 0.15% of monoacetyl and diacetyl impurity and less than about 0.15% of N-7 alkylated isomer impurity.
- the inventors have developed an efficient process for the preparation of N -acetyl- 9-(l,3-diacetoxy-2-propoxymethyl) guanine in pure form, by treating the N-9 alkylated isomer with one or more of solvents and recovering the pure N-9 isomer by the removal of the solvent.
- the solution of N 2 -acetyl-9-(l,3-diacetoxy-2 -propoxymethyl) guanine may be obtained by dissolving N 2 -acetyl-9-(l,3-diacetoxy-2 -propoxymethyl) guanine in a suitable solvent.
- a suitable solvent such a solution may be obtained directly from a reaction in which N 2 -acetyl-9-(l,3-diacetoxy-2-propoxymethyl) guanine is formed.
- the solvent may be removed from the solution by a technique which includes, for example, distillation, distillation under vacuum, filtration, filtration under vacuum, decantation, and centrifugation.
- suitable solvent includes any solvent or solvent mixture in which N-9 alkylated isomer is soluble, including, for example, lower alkanol, ketones, chlorinated solvents, water and mixtures thereof.
- alkanol include those primary, secondary and tertiary alcohols having from one to six carbon atoms.
- Suitable lower alkanol solvents include methanol, ethanol, denatured spirit, n-propanol, isopropanol, n- butanol, isobutanol and t-butanol.
- ketones include solvents such as acetone, 2-butanone, and 4-methylpentan-2-one.
- a suitable chlorinated solvent includes one or more of dichloromethane, dichloroethane and chloroform. Mixtures of all of these solvents are also contemplated.
- the solution containing N -acetyl-9-(l,3-diacetoxy-2- propoxymethyl) guanine can be cooled followed by filtration to remove any unreacted solids before the removal of the solvent.
- additional solvent can be added to residue obtained after removal of the solvent and it can be cooled before filtration.
- the product obtained may be further or additionally dried to achieve the desired moisture values.
- the product may be further or additionally dried in a tray drier, dried under vacuum and/or in a Fluid Bed Drier.
- the solution containing the mixture of N-7 and N-9 isomers may be heated for dissolution, or may be cooled to separate out the product or the slurry may further be cooled prior to filtration or the solution may be seeded with seed crystals of the product to enhance precipitation of the product.
- N 2 -Acetyl-9-(l,3-diacetoxy-2-propoxymethyl) guanine so obtained may be hydrolyzed to give ganciclovir by the methods known in the literature (J.E. Martin et. al. J. Med. Chem., 1983, 26, 759-761).
